(حديث مرفوع) حَدَّثَنَا
م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 جَعْفَرٍ ، حَدَّثَنَا
شُعْبَةُ ، عَنْ
عَمْرِو بْنِ دِينَارٍ ، قَالَ : سَمِعْتُ
جَابِرًا ، يَقُولُ : كَانَ مُعَاذٌ يُصَلِّي مَعَ رَسُولِ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، ثُمَّ يَرْجِعُ فَيَؤُمُّ قَوْمَهُ ، قَالَ : فَصَلَّى بِهِمْ مَرَّةً الْعِشَاءَ ، فَقَرَأَ : سُورَةَ الْبَقَرَةِ ، فَعَمَدَ رَجُلٌ فَانْصَرَفَ ، فَكَانَ مُعَاذٌ يَنَالُ مِنْهُ ، فَبَلَغَ ذَلِكَ النَّبِيَّ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 فَقَالَ : " فَتَّانٌ ، فَتَّانٌ " ، أَوْ قَالَ : " فَاتِنٌ ، فَاتِنٌ ، فَاتِنٌ " ، وَأَمَرَهُ بِسُورَتَيْنِ مِنْ أَوْسَطِ الْمُفَصَّلِ ، قَالَ عَمْرٌو : لَا أَحْفَظُهُمَا .
It is narrated from Sayyiduna Jabir (may Allah be pleased with him) that Sayyiduna Mu'adh bin Jabal used to first perform the Isha prayer with the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him), then go to his own people and lead them in prayer there. Once, the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) delayed the Isha prayer. Sayyiduna Mu'adh prayed with the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) and, upon returning to his people, began reciting Surah Al-Baqarah. Seeing this, a man performed his own prayer and left. Later, someone said to him, "You have become a hypocrite." He replied, "I am not a hypocrite." Then he went and mentioned this matter to the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him): "Mu'adh prays with you, then comes back and leads us in prayer. We are people who work in the fields and labor with our own hands. He came and led us in prayer and began with Surah Al-Baqarah." The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) said to him twice, "Mu'adh, do you want to put people to trial? Why do you not recite Surah Al-A'la and Surah Ash-Shams?"
